mixed races
Perhaps the most interesting and challenging group of people for the plastic surgeon is also the fastest growing. People of mixed ethnic background. This is common in Latin America where a blend of native indian and spanish ancestry is common. In this group we would include the north american hispanic and mexican mestizo cultures. In some areas this culture is enriched with an african background. It is interesting that these areas of the world are also places were there is wide acceptance of cosmetic surgery. The surgery for patients in this group is complex and interesting and cannot be covered briefly. Many different patterns and pictures have emerged and there is no other situation where the surgeon must evaluate each case carefully and advise individually. It is true that resurfacing operations tend to be less successful and that aging change operation such as facelifting often do well. Liposuction and abdominoplasty are commonly requested. Cosmetic surgery seems especially well accepted by men in this group. Rhinoplasty is also common among the north american hispanics and is often a reflection of the nose type seen in southern europeans. In some cases a flattening of the nose occurs that causes the patient to request augmentation or elevation. This may reflect either asian or african background.
